A Clinical study to Evaluate the effect of Chakramarda Beeja Churna application with Mulaka Swarasa in Dadru Kusta

Evaluation and applied study of "Dvandva Karmaja Samyoga" with reference to Chakranarda Beeja Churna with Mulaka Swarasa application in Dadru Kusta

Conditions

Health Condition 1: L309- Dermatitis, unspecified

Interventions

Intervention1: Application of Chakramarda beeja churna with mulaka swarasa: Application of Chakramarda beeja churna with mulaka swarasa . one karsha (12gm)of triphala churna with Luke warm water advis

Eligibility

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: 1.Subjects of 18-60years of age group irrespective of gender, caste and religion. 2. Diagnosed case of Dadru Kushta fulfilling subjective criteria. 3. Chronicity within one year

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: 1. Pregnant and lactation women. 2. Subjects with association of any other skin allergy and systematic disorder. 3. Subjects being on other system of medicine for skin disease.

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Reduction in the signs and symptoms of Dadru kustaTimepoint: 15 Days

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
Change in color and size of the lesionTimepoint: 15 Days
